Project Planning Lead
18 Month Fixed Term Contract
Bradford & Home working
Up to £59,000
Your new role
To plan and coordinate projects and activities in Primavera P6 for the programme of work they are assigned to. Co-ordinate and lead planning process for new and refurbished assets across the programme via collaborative working between Asset Planning, Service Delivery and the Delivery partner teams. Ensure health and safety excellence; regulatory compliance; operational integrity and resilience; operational efficiency by providing Planning Leadership to achieve the programmes required outcomes in the most efficient way.
As part of the integrated Project Controls team, you will be responsible for work with the team to ensure consistency in approach and data across the programme, and in particularly will work closely with the Project Control lead on their assigned projects to ensure a fully integrated approach to assessing and reporting project performance.
Responsibilities
Create end to end Project and programme baseline
Measure progress and schedule impact on key milestones
Provide assurance on schedules submitted by Delivery Partners
Chair regular scheduling to discuss milestone movement, seeking solutions to mitigate any schedule risk
Carry out 'what-if' scenario planning of sites to ensure the optimum schedule is achieved.
Work closely with Project controls lead and wider cost, risk and change management teams to provide a fully integrated performance approach
Work as part of the programme team to deliver excellent performance by understanding how their individual performance links into achieving the team's wider objectives
Support the Project Delivery teams with compensation event analysis
Proactive approach to managing interfaces and potential blockers, working with project teams to reduce schedule risk
Ensure robust schedule data
Understanding and developing best practice and innovation supported with measuring and monitoring the implementation of these new ideas
Experience needed
Significant experience in all aspects of planning and scheduling Including but not limited to; Work Breakdown structure creation, Preparation and update of logic-linked programme, Baseline management, Critical path analysis and Preparation of periodic reports.
An understanding of Risk management and change management
Experience or knowledge of resource loading programmes, progress measurement, earned value analysis, completion forecasting and status reporting
Excellent communication skills
Ability to challenge undesired behaviours appropriately
Experience of utilities or large Infrastructure projects.
Good IT skills and the ability to operate professional planning tools such as P6
Ability to collaborate and build relationships across the wider teams
Experience of driving sustainable performance against challenging business targets.
Previous experience in a commercially orientated environment.
Previous experience gained within the water industry or within the broader utilities, process or manufacturing industry sectors.
Knowledge of Project Controls tools and principals.
